NWFL Launches Mandatory Digital Registration and Licensing Portal for 2025/26 Premiership season
The Nigeria Women Football League (NWFL) has launched a compulsory digital portal for player registration and club licensing, beginning on Friday, November 14, 2025, ahead of the 2025/26 season. NWFL Annual Assembly Confirms November Kick-Off for 2025/26 Premiership Season
The Nigeria Women Football League (NWFL) held its Annual General Assembly (AGA) on Wednesday in Port Harcourt, setting the stage for the 2025/26 NWFL Premiership season, officially scheduled to kick off on November 26, 2025. Port Harcourt to Host 2025 NWFL Annual General Assembly
The Nigeria Women Football League (NWFL) has officially announced that its 2025 Annual General Assembly (AGA) will be held in Port Harcourt, Rivers State, on Wednesday, October 29, 2025. 2025 NWFL season ends with Nationwide as four teams earn promotion to the Championship
The 2025 NWFL Nationwide has officially concluded with four outstanding teams sealing promotion to the prestigious NWFL Championship for the 2026 season. Dreamstar Ladies of Lagos secured an immediate and triumphant return to the second tier as Group A winners. Ghana’s Charlotte Adjei wins NWFL Premiership Goalkeeper of the Season, Claims ₦200,000 Judith Chime Prize
Remo Stars Ladies’ shot-stopper Charlotte Adjei has been named the 2024/25 Nigeria Women Football League (NWFL) Premiership Goalkeeper of the Season, becoming the second foreign player in three years to claim the honor. Janet Akekeromowei named NWFL Premiership MVP in debut season
Janet Akekeromowei of Nasarawa Amazons has been named the Most Valuable Player (MVP) of the 2024/25 Nigeria Women Football League (NWFL) Premiership season—an extraordinary feat in her first professional campaign. Remo Stars Ladies forward Bolaji Olamide Wins NWFL Premiership Top Scorer Award
In a thrilling conclusion to the 2024/25 Nigeria Women Football League (NWFL) Premiership season, Remo Stars Ladies’ Bolaji Olamide emerged as the league’s top goal scorer. Olamide, a former Sunshine Queens player, scored a total of 15 goals, with 14 of those coming in the regular season.
